Introduction

Beedan 50mg Tablet contains dasatinib, a targeted cancer medication used to treat blood cancers in children aged one year and above and adults. It is prescribed for newly diagnosed Philadelphia chromosome-positive (Ph+) chronic myeloid leukemia (CML) in the chronic phase, as well as Ph+ ac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) in patients who have not responded to other treatments.

Chronic myeloid leukemia is a type of blood cancer where the body produces too many white blood cells due to changes in the Philadelphia chromosome. Acute lymphoblastic leukemia is the most common blood cancer affecting children, characterized by rapid multiplication of lymphocytes (white blood cells) that survive longer than normal. Beedan 50mg Tablet works by blocking abnormal proteins that signal cancer cell growth, helping to prevent or slow the spread of cancer cells.

Key points

  • Used for chronic myeloid leukemia (CML) and Philadelphia chromosome-positive acute lymphoblastic leukemia (Ph+ ALL)
  • Suitable for children aged 1 year and above and adults
  • Works by blocking proteins that trigger cancer cell growth
  • Requires regular blood monitoring during treatment

Therapeutic Uses

  • Treatment of newly diagnosed Philadelphia chromosome-positive (Ph+) chronic myeloid leukemia in the chronic phase
  • Treatment of Philadelphia chromosome-positive acute lymphoblastic leukemia (Ph+ ALL) in patients resistant to prior therapies
  • Management of chronic myeloid leukemia in children aged 1 year and above and adults

How it Works

Dasatinib in Beedan 50mg Tablet works as a tyrosine kinase inhibitor by blocking abnormal proteins that send growth signals to cancer cells. By preventing these signals, the medication helps stop cancer cells from multiplying and spreading throughout the body, slowing disease progression.

How to Take

Take Beedan 50mg Tablet exactly as prescribed by your doctor. Swallow the tablet whole without breaking, crushing, or chewing it. Your doctor will determine the appropriate dose and frequency based on your condition severity and other individual factors.

Instructions

  • Take the tablet at the same time each day to maintain consistent drug levels
  • Swallow the tablet whole—do not break, crush, or chew it
  • Do not stop taking this medication without consulting your doctor, even if you feel better
  • Keep all scheduled appointments for blood tests and medical checkups

Timing

With or without food

Missed dose

If you miss a dose, take it as soon as you remember on the same day. If you remember the next day, skip the missed dose and resume your regular schedule. Do not double the dose to make up for a missed one.

Overdose

If you suspect an overdose, contact your doctor or emergency services immediately. Do not attempt to treat an overdose on your own.

Side Effects

  • Diarrhea, nausea, vomiting, and loss of appetite
  • Headache, muscle pain, weakness, and fatigue
  • Skin rash, cough, and breathing difficulties
  • High or low blood pressure and rapid heart rate
  • Unusual bleeding or bruising, fever, and signs of infection
  • Severe allergic reactions, fluid retention, and swelling

Safety Advice

Pregnancy

Unsafe

Beedan 50mg Tablet is not recommended during pregnancy as it may harm the developing fetus. Your doctor will discuss potential risks if the medication is necessary.

Tip: Women of childbearing age should use effective birth control methods during treatment and for 30 days after the final dose. Inform your doctor immediately if you become pregnant while taking this medication.

Breastfeeding

Unsafe

It is unknown whether dasatinib passes into breast milk. Breastfeeding is not recommended during treatment due to potential harm to the infant.

Tip: Do not breastfeed while taking Beedan 50mg Tablet. Continue to avoid breastfeeding for 2 weeks after your final dose.

Liver Disease

Consult Doctor

Patients with liver disease may require dose adjustments as the liver is important for metabolizing this medication.

Tip: Inform your doctor if you have liver disease before starting treatment. Your doctor will prescribe an appropriate dose based on your liver function.

Lung Disease

Consult Doctor

Safety of Beedan 50mg Tablet in patients with lung conditions has not been fully established. Close monitoring may be necessary.

Tip: Inform your doctor if you have any lung disease, breathing difficulties, chest pain, or persistent cough before starting treatment.

Heart Problems

Consult Doctor

This medication may affect heart function and blood pressure. Patients with existing heart conditions require special consideration.

Tip: Disclose any heart problems, including chest pain or irregular heart rate, to your doctor before treatment.

Alcohol

Consult Doctor

The safety of consuming alcohol while taking Beedan 50mg Tablet is not established.

Tip: Consult your doctor for specific advice about alcohol consumption during your treatment.

Driving

Unsafe

This medication may cause symptoms such as breathlessness, dizziness, or altered consciousness, which can impair your ability to drive safely.

Tip: Avoid driving or operating machinery if you experience breathlessness, dizziness, altered consciousness, or other symptoms that affect your alertness.

Bleeding Disorders

Consult Doctor

Beedan 50mg Tablet may reduce blood clotting ability. Patients with existing bleeding problems require careful monitoring.

Tip: Inform your doctor if you have any bleeding disorders or are taking blood-thinning medications before starting treatment.

Hepatitis B

Consult Doctor

Patients with hepatitis B infection require special monitoring as this medication may affect liver function.

Tip: Tell your doctor if you have hepatitis B infection before starting treatment.

FAQs

Can children use Beedan 50mg tablet?
Beedan 50mg Tablet is suitable for children aged 1 year and above. It is not recommended for infants under one year of age. Always follow your doctor's instructions regarding dosage for children.
Can Beedan 50mg tablet cause hair loss?
Yes, hair loss is a reported side effect of Beedan 50mg Tablet. If you experience hair loss or if it becomes bothersome, consult your doctor for advice. Hair loss typically resolves after treatment completion.
Is Beedan 50mg tablet a chemotherapy drug?
Yes, Beedan 50mg Tablet is a targeted cancer therapy medication that belongs to a class of drugs called tyrosine kinase inhibitors. It works differently from traditional chemotherapy by specifically blocking cancer cell growth signals.
Should Beedan 50mg tablet be taken with food?
Beedan 50mg Tablet can be taken with or without food. However, avoid consuming grapefruit and grapefruit juices while taking this medication. If you take antacids, space them 2 hours before or after taking this tablet.
Which population is contraindicated from taking Beedan 50mg tablet?
Beedan 50mg Tablet is contraindicated in pregnant and breastfeeding women due to potential harm to the fetus or infant. It is also not recommended for children under one year of age. Always inform your doctor about your medical conditions before starting treatment.

Drug Interactions

Beedan 50mg Tablet may interact with various medications, nutritional supplements, and herbal products. It is essential to inform your doctor about all medicines you take before starting treatment to avoid harmful interactions and unwanted side effects.

Major interactions

  • Antacid medications—take antacids at least 2 hours before or 2 hours after Beedan 50mg Tablet
  • Grapefruit and grapefruit juice—avoid consuming these while taking this medication

Precautions

  • Inform your doctor about all prescription and over-the-counter medicines
  • Disclose all vitamin supplements, herbal products, and nutritional supplements
  • Space antacid doses appropriately to avoid interference with tablet absorption
  • Avoid grapefruit products throughout treatment

Important

Certain medications may interact with Beedan 50mg Tablet and cause undesirable side effects. Always consult your healthcare provider before taking any new medication alongside this treatment.
